DESCRIPTION


The organization is seeking vendors to provide entrepreneurship center services that support education, mentorship, access to funding, and ecosystem connectivity. The services are intended to contribute to local economic development and student career readiness through structured entrepreneurship programs.

Programs should equip early-stage entrepreneurs with tools and frameworks to validate business ideas through direct customer engagement. Services may include helping participants identify customer segments, test assumptions, develop evidence-based business models, and refine customer discovery strategies through one-on-one coaching.

Vendors may support one or more areas, including business development strategy; digital tools and platforms such as CRM, learning management, booking, reporting, and websites; marketing and community outreach; event planning and management; entrepreneurial research and assessment; technology testing and validation; access to capital services or platforms; micro-loan program design and implementation; investment readiness programming; and partnerships with lenders or investor networks. The contract period will be two years. Questions are due by August 13, 2026, and proposals are due by August 25, 2026.
